Did you know that crawling like a lion builds shoulder stability, that in turn helps children with things like fine motor skills (drawing, hand writing, using scissors, using cutlery to name just a few!) Shoulder stability is also important for ball skills and sports! Or did you know that scratching your opposite arm like an Orangutan works on an important skill called crossing midline? Crossing midline is important for things like tying shoe laces and writing across a page.
